What you need to apply for International Finance at Nurtingen-Geislingen University (NGU)
Evidence of proficiency in English, at least at level B2 (according to the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ages). Please note that you have to submit only one of the following:
Test of English as a Foreign Language -TOEFL- with at least 500 points (paper based) or 173 points (computer based) or 61 points (internet based)
International English Language Testing System Academic - IELTS with at least a 5.5 overall band score
Cambridge English: Business Vantage - BEC Vantage
Cambridge English: First – FCE
Cambridge English: Advanced – CAE
Cambridge English: Proficiency – CPE
Advanced Placement International English Language Exam (APIEL) with a minimum rating of 4
Test of English for International Communication (TOEIC) with at least 785 points
Language certificate for B2 level according to the "Common European Framework for Languages"
First degree from a programme conducted completely in the English language
Thank you for your interest in our Master of Science International Finance programme (www.hfwu.de/ifm). You can apply to the programme with an official transcript stating that you are in your last semester of studies and expected graduation date. This document should also include the grades you have earned up until now. You are however required to show your final bachelor degree at the time of enrolment.
Any documents concerning international and / or work experience (ie letter of recommendation, etc.)
For a detailled list of the necessary documents, please check the information provided by our Student Administration Office. Generally the following documents are needed:
Proof of a degree in Business, Business Law, Economics or Management from a German institute of higher education or vocational college or a comparable degree from a foreign institute of higher education.) Proof of having completed a higher education degree or an equivalent qualification pursuant to section 59 (1) LHG in one of the following programs. In the case of bachelor’s degrees with less than 210 ECTS credit points, but no less than 150 ECTS credits points (or 130 ECTS credit points in a degree from Duale Hochschule Baden-Württemberg), the admissions committee will check if the qualifications set by the admission requirements are met.
Declaration of study motivation, typewritten, max. 2 pages, in German or English language

Curriculum Vitae with personal details, education and work experience (optional)
Chinese, Indian and Vietnamese applicants also need to attach the Original Certificate of the "Akademische Prüfstelle des Kulturreferates der Deutschen Botschaft" (APS) from their country
International applicants who received their former degree abroad have to get it first recognized by the [Studienkolleg Konstanz ](https://www.htwg-konstanz.de/en/academics/center-for-international-students-konstanz/recognition-of-certificates/procedure). This recognition can be requested throughout the year.

How Do I Apply to the IFM Programme?
We are currently changing the application process from uni-assist to our internal SELMA system. Please check out the information provided by our Student Administration Office
Please keep in mind:
the application portal for the intake of 2024 will be open from beginning March 2024 until June 1st 2024
Application Deadline: each year June 1st - for admission to the winter semester which usually starts towards the end of September/beginning of October each year . The deadline applies to all applicants (EU and Non-EU).
the programme only starts in the winter semester each year. A start in the summer semester is not possible
Our admissions office will inform you by post with the results of the selection process at the end of June / beginning of July.
Please be aware that we can not give out any information by phone, fax or email regarding acceptance.
Your acceptance / decline letter will be sent to the correspondence address.

Additional fee information
All enrolled degree seeking students (EU and non-EU) are required to pay registration fees amounting to approx. 190 € each semester.
From winter semester 2017/2018, international students (non-EU) are also required to pay tuition fees amounting to 1500 € each semester.
